Bridging the Literacy Gap in Rural North Dakota

In North Dakota, rural families are disproportionately affected by limited access to educational resources. According to the U.S. Census Bureau, approximately 20% of the state's population lives in a rural area, where educational facilities and libraries are scarce. With many communities spread across vast distances and geographic isolation, children in these areas often lack fundamental resources essential for fostering a culture of reading and literacy.

Families residing in rural North Dakota frequently find themselves confronting barriers related to access and engagement with educational materials. The lack of nearby libraries means that children from low-income families may fall behind their peers in more urbanized areas. Furthermore, the state's diverse demographic, which includes Native American populations who often face systemic disparities, exacerbates these challenges as access to critical materials and resources can be further limited.

To address the pressing need for literacy enhancement, funding has been allocated for mobile library services aimed specifically at rural communities in North Dakota. These mobile libraries are designed to reach children where they live, breaking down barriers associated with transportation and accessibility. Equipped with a diverse array of books and educational resources, these mobile services not only promote reading but also offer educational programs designed to encourage parental involvement and community engagement.

Furthermore, tailored programs accompanying the mobile libraries focus on age-appropriate activities for different demographics, thereby fostering a love of reading among children of all backgrounds. Collaborating with local schools and community organizations, these efforts aim to create a sustainable impact on literacy standards across the state, especially in regions where educational inequities are most pronounced.

Who is Eligible for Funding in North Dakota

Organizations that wish to apply for funding for mobile library services in North Dakota must fulfill specific eligibility criteria outlined by state program administrators. Non-profit organizations, libraries, and educational institutions that demonstrate a commitment to improving literacy in rural areas are encouraged to apply. Given the geographic peculiarities of North Dakota, applicants must also include plans for reaching underserved communities effectively.

The application process necessitates detailed proposals that describe how the mobile library service will function, including projected routes and schedules, the types of resources to be provided, and how they will address the needs of specific populations in target areas. Proposals should also outline partnerships with local schools and community organizations, enhancing the program's reach and effectiveness.
